Bob Wesolowski![]() ![]() Mega Fish Posts: 1379 Kudos: 1462 Registered: 14-Oct-2004 ![]() ![]() | Discus will often spawn frequently trying to establish a viable egg clutch. After fertilizing the eggs, the pair will guard the eggs and "mouth" them to prevent fungus. During this period things sometimes go wrong. Inexperienced fish will forget to replace the egg and swallow the egg. For some reason, this is frequently the female. You can prevent this behavior by removing the female after spawning. If your eggs do fungus up, tghe parents will certainly eat the eggs. Fungus is caused by tank conditions.
